# Second-Source Supplier Search (Managers Only)

Audience: sales leads. Our sole supplier of optical housings, Drellick Components, has shown rising lead times and a price escalation clause triggering next quarter. Procurement has shortlisted three alternates: Ombrave Precision, Taltyn Works, and Cassfield Moulding. Qualification samples are due within six weeks; no customer commitments should reference the change yet. The commercial rationale appears in the confidential note below.

management briefing: Casvanek Logistics plans to lower the Druox list price by 49.1 percent in April. The board signed off on a budget of $16.5 million for Project Rusath. The renewal with Kasvanix Partners closes at $67.9 million a year, 33.9 percent above the last contract. Project Casath slips by one quarter because of the staffing delay.

## GarageSense Environments

Welcome aboard! GarageSense (our parking-garage occupancy feed) runs in three environments: dev, staging, and prod. Dev resets nightly, staging mirrors the Belmarsh garage sensors, prod is live. Don't point load tests at prod, ever. Staging currently runs with the following configuration.

config for kafof-bawef:
holath:
  log_level: debug
  metrics_host: metrics.holath.qorvelsys.internal
  pin: 2191
  pool_size: 32

Runbook fragment: Date localization in Quillbase. All user-facing dates must pass through the LocaleFormat service; never call raw formatting in templates. The service resolves the user's locale from profile settings first, then browser hints, falling back to ISO 8601. Edge cases: Marovian calendar offsets and week-start differences in the Teldane region. Before changing any format token, run the snapshot suite. The full token reference is on the page below.

runbook for badug-kadup: https://confluence.zemvarlabs.internal/projects/browse/display/projects/bd1b